Sankarani River history and protected-area timeline
The Sankarani River has long served the communities along its banks, with its watershed traditionally supporting agriculture and enriched by deposits of iron and gold. Long before modern infrastructure reached the region, the river sat within a landscape of established human settlement, farming, and resource use.
A particularly notable historical connection lies with the Mali Empire, one of the great medieval West African states. At the height of its power, between the 13th and 16th centuries, the capital of the Mali Empire is believed to have been located at Niani, on the banks of the Sankarani, anchoring the river's place in the early political and cultural history of the broader Niger River region.
In the modern era, the river's history is closely linked to the development ambitions of Mali. Construction of the Sélingué Dam began in 1980 with the goal of supplying electricity to Bamako. Inaugurated on 13 December 1982, the dam and its accompanying hydroelectric plant were at that time the largest development project in Malian history. Hydroelectric capacity was developed at the site, and an irrigation scheme was established to compensate people relocated by the project and to support broader agricultural activity along the river. These interventions transformed a portion of the river corridor, reshaping both natural floodplain dynamics and human land use patterns in the area.
Sankarani River landscape and geographic character
The Sankarani River originates in the rolling highlands of the Fouta Djallon in Guinea, a region characterised by elevated plateaus, deeply incised valleys, and one of West Africa's most distinctive highland landscapes. From its headwaters, the river flows generally northward, transitioning from steep highland terrain into flatter alluvial environments as it approaches the broader Niger basin.
As it continues north into Mali, the river's character shifts toward broad, seasonally flooded floodplains and lowland ecosystems typical of the upper Niger plains. The crossings between Guinea, Ivory Coast, and Mali give the river corridor a strongly international character, and its floodplain in Guinea, a discontinuous stretch of roughly 170 kilometres, remains one of its defining physical features.
Along its length, the river sustains gallery forests lining its banks, narrow ribbons of woodland that thrive on the moisture of the riparian zone. Although the Selingue Dam's reservoir covered substantial portions of the original gallery forest habitat, other stretches continue to preserve characteristic riparian woodland patterns, lending the river corridor a layered and ecologically distinctive visual identity.
Sankarani River ecosystems, habitats, and plant life
The Sankarani River's ecological character is shaped by its floodplain dynamics, its gallery forest corridors, and its position within the broader upper Niger basin ecosystem. The river's discontinuous floodplain, extending roughly 170 kilometres through Guinea, hosts a mixture of seasonally flooded grasslands, wetland margins, and channels of slow-moving water that support a rich diversity of aquatic and semi-aquatic habitats.
The river's banks have historically supported gallery forests, the dense, linear woodlands that follow African rivers through otherwise drier country. These forests are a defining feature of the river's ecology, providing habitat continuity along riparian corridors and contributing significantly to local biodiversity. Their partial inundation by the Selingue Dam's reservoir illustrates how natural flow regulation has reshaped the river's habitat structure, though gallery forest elements persist in upstream and unaffected stretches.
The Sankarani's status as a Ramsar-listed wetland, designated under the official name Sankarani-Fié in 2002, reflects the international recognition of its wetland value. The combination of floodplain habitats, riparian forests, and its role in sustaining downstream fisheries establishes the river as an ecological anchor within the greater Niger River watershed.

Sankarani River conservation status and protection priorities
The Sankarani River holds notable conservation significance, principally through its designation as the Sankarani-Fié Ramsar Wetland on 17 January 2002. This designation reflects international recognition of the river's floodplain, gallery forest, and broader wetland habitats as environmentally valuable ecosystems worthy of protection.
The river corridor also plays an important hydrological role within the upper Niger basin, sustaining downstream wetlands and contributing to regional water security. The presence of the Sélingué Dam has reshaped portions of the river's natural flow regime, with the reservoir covering parts of the original gallery forest habitat. This transformation highlights the ongoing tension between hydropower development and the preservation of natural floodplain ecosystems.
Recognition through the Ramsar framework provides a meaningful anchor for the river's conservation status, although broader protection and management of the watershed is shaped by the multiple national jurisdictions the river crosses, as well as by continuing demands from agriculture, fisheries, and energy production along its length.
